What's Happening?
Disney+ and Hulu have announced a new video podcasting deal with iHeartMedia, which includes six iHeartPodcasts titles. The collaboration will begin with the Jonas Brothers' podcast 'Hey Jonas!' streaming on both platforms starting August 14. The podcast,
hosted by Kevin, Joe, and Nick Jonas, promises to offer a playful and intimate look at the brothers, coinciding with the premiere of 'Camp Rock 3' on Disney+. Other podcasts included in the deal are 'Pod Meets World', 'Desperately Devoted', 'Fake Doctors, Real Friends with Zach and Donald', 'StraightioLab', and 'Thanks Dad with Ego Nwodim'. The deal aims to expand the reach of these podcasts by offering video editions, enhancing the streaming experience for fans.
Why It's Important?
This deal signifies a strategic move by Disney+ and Hulu to diversify their content offerings and tap into the growing popularity of podcasts. By integrating video podcasts, the platforms can attract a broader audience and enhance user engagement. The inclusion of popular personalities like the Jonas Brothers and other well-known figures from shows like 'Scrubs' and 'Desperate Housewives' is likely to draw in fans from various demographics, potentially increasing subscription rates and viewer retention. This partnership also highlights the evolving nature of media consumption, where audiences seek more interactive and varied content experiences.
